找到 6691 篇文章 關於 Javascript

如何使用 JavaScript 動態停用按鈕元素?

Dishebh Bhayana
更新於 2023年8月2日 19:15:37

2K+ 閱讀量

在這篇文章中,我們將學習如何使用 javascript 動態停用按鈕 HTML 元素,藉助於“disabled”屬性。“disabled”屬性在 HTML 按鈕元素中接受布林值(true 或 false),根據值的不同,它停用按鈕並使其失去功能,即不可點選。我們可以使用此屬性透過將“disabled”屬性設定為“true”來停用 HTML 中的任何按鈕。語法停用按鈕讓我們透過一些示例來理解這一點 - 示例 1在此示例中,我們將透過傳遞“disabled”屬性來停用按鈕元素... 閱讀更多

如何在 JavaScript 中錄製和播放音訊?

Mohit Panchasara
更新於 2023年7月26日 12:38:11

5K+ 閱讀量

您是否也希望向您的 Web 應用程式新增自定義音訊錄製功能?如果是,那麼您來對地方了,因為在本教程中,我們將學習如何使用 JavaScript 錄製和播放音訊。一些應用程式(如 Discord)允許您錄製音訊並將其儲存在其中,以便隨時播放。錄製的音訊還可以用作有趣的模因、Discord 會議中的警報等。我們還可以使用 JavaScript 的 mediaRecorder API 向我們的 Web 應用程式新增錄製音訊功能。在這裡,我們將學習分步指南... 閱讀更多

如何在 JavaScript 中使用立即呼叫函式表示式防止覆蓋?

Mohit Panchasara
更新於 2023年7月26日 12:23:25

277 閱讀量

JavaScript 允許開發人員向網頁新增功能和行為。開發人員需要建立多個函式和變數才能向網頁的不同部分新增功能。在開發即時應用程式時,多個開發人員會在同一個專案上工作。因此,在與多個開發人員協作時,避免無意中覆蓋函式和變數是必要的。在本教程中,我們將學習如何使用立即呼叫函式表示式防止覆蓋。覆蓋問題例如,兩位同事正在同一個專案上工作,並且都在程式碼中定義了 printAge() 函式併合並了程式碼。現在,... 閱讀更多

Web Workers:JavaScript 中的多執行緒

Mukul Latiyan
更新於 2023年7月25日 14:47:49

201 閱讀量

隨著 Web 應用程式變得越來越複雜和要求越來越高,對高效且響應迅速的處理的需求也變得越來越重要。JavaScript 作為一種單執行緒語言,有時難以處理可能導致使用者介面緩慢和應用程式無響應的繁重計算任務。但是,隨著 Web Workers 的引入,JavaScript 獲得了利用多執行緒的能力,從而提高了效能並增強了使用者體驗。在本文中,我們將深入探討 Web Workers 的世界,並探討它們如何在 JavaScript 中實現多執行緒。理解對 Web Workers 的需求在傳統的 JavaScript 中,單執行緒特性意味著所有任務,包括 DOM... 閱讀更多

Web Components:使用 JavaScript 構建自定義元素

Mukul Latiyan
更新於 2023年7月25日 14:46:55

306 閱讀量

Web Components 是在 Web 應用程式中構建可重用且封裝的 UI 元素的強大工具。它們允許開發人員建立具有自己的標記、樣式和行為的自定義元素,這些元素可以輕鬆地跨不同專案重用並與其他開發人員共享。在本文中,我們將探討 Web Components 的基礎知識,並學習如何使用 JavaScript 構建自定義元素。什麼是 Web Components?Web Components 是一組 Web 平臺 API,允許您建立可重用、封裝和可組合的 UI 元素。它們由三個主要規範組成:自定義元素、Shadow DOM 和 HTML 模板。... 閱讀更多

WebAssembly (Wasm) 與 JavaScript

Mukul Latiyan
更新於 2023年7月25日 14:45:51

279 閱讀量

您是否曾經想過是否可以在不犧牲 JavaScript 提供的可移植性和安全性的情況下在 Web 上執行高效能應用程式?好吧,別再懷疑了!隨著 WebAssembly (Wasm) 的引入,現在可以在 Web 應用程式中實現類似本機的效能,同時仍然利用 JavaScript 的強大功能。在本文中,我們將探討 WebAssembly 的基礎知識,以及如何將其與 JavaScript 結合使用以開啟新的可能性。什麼是 WebAssembly (Wasm)?WebAssembly,通常稱為 Wasm,是一種專為 Web 瀏覽器設計的二進位制指令格式。它是一種低階... 閱讀更多

使用 TypeScript 進行 JavaScript 靜態型別檢查

Mukul Latiyan
更新於 2023年7月25日 14:44:03

626 閱讀量

JavaScript 是一種流行的程式語言,以其靈活性和動態特性而聞名。但是,這種靈活性有時會導致大型應用程式中出現意外錯誤和故障。為了解決此問題,引入了 TypeScript 作為 JavaScript 的超集,它提供了靜態型別檢查功能。在本文中,我們將探討使用 TypeScript 進行 JavaScript 靜態型別檢查的基礎知識,以及程式碼示例和解釋,以幫助您入門。什麼是靜態型別檢查?靜態型別檢查是一個在編譯時而不是在執行時將型別與變數、函式引數和函式返回值相關聯的過程。... 閱讀更多

使用 Next.js 和 JavaScript 進行伺服器端渲染 (SSR)

Mukul Latiyan
更新於 2023年7月25日 14:41:25

402 閱讀量

在 Web 開發領域,提供快速而無縫的使用者體驗至關重要。實現此目標的一種方法是透過伺服器端渲染 (SSR),這是一種在將網頁傳送到客戶端之前在伺服器上渲染網頁的技術。SSR 提供了許多好處,包括提高效能、最佳化 SEO 和改善使用者互動。在本文中,我們將探討使用 Next.js 的 SSR 基礎知識,Next.js 是一個流行的 JavaScript 框架,用於構建伺服器渲染的 React 應用程式。什麼是伺服器端渲染 (SSR)?傳統上,Web 應用程式依賴於客戶端渲染,其中整個渲染過程在瀏覽器中使用 JavaScript 進行。這... 閱讀更多

使用 JavaScript 框架進行伺服器端渲染 (SSR)

Mukul Latiyan
更新於 2023年7月25日 14:48:54

472 閱讀量

在當今快節奏的 Web 開發環境中,提供高效能且對搜尋引擎友好的網站至關重要。實現此目標的一種有效方法是透過伺服器端渲染 (SSR)。在本文中,我們將探討如何使用 JavaScript 框架實現 SSR,以及程式碼示例、解釋和輸出,以幫助您在專案中充分利用 SSR。瞭解伺服器端渲染伺服器端渲染涉及在伺服器上生成 HTML 內容並將其傳送到客戶端,在客戶端立即顯示。這種方法與客戶端渲染 (CSR) 相反,在客戶端渲染中,瀏覽器從伺服器檢索最少的 HTML 並... 閱讀更多

機器人技術:使用 Raspberry Pi 和 JavaScript 構建自主機器人

Mukul Latiyan
更新於 2023年7月25日 14:38:06

267 閱讀量

近年來,機器人技術領域發生了重大轉變,轉向開源技術和平臺。Raspberry Pi 就是這樣一個廣受歡迎的平臺,它是一款小巧且價格合理的單板計算機。結合 JavaScript 的強大功能和多功能性,開發人員現在可以踏上激動人心的機器人之旅。在本文中,我們將探討如何使用 Raspberry Pi 和 JavaScript 構建自主機器人,深入探討程式碼示例、解釋及其輸出。設定 Raspberry Pi在我們深入 JavaScript 機器人領域之前,必須設定我們的 Raspberry Pi... 閱讀更多

廣告
© . All rights reserved.